Exhibition in Yambol displays almost 300 eggs from more than 60 countries

3
Photo: BTA

An exhibition of almost 300 exhibits is on in the town of Yambol until 4 May, and the exhibits are...eggs from 63 countries, all of them belonging to psychologist Vanya Velkova, holder of a number of prizes and awards.


The eggs are from Bulgaria, and from many European countries and the US, but also from some faraway countries like Peru, Brazil, Guatemala, Cuba, Mexico, Vietnam, Egypt, Afghanistan, India, Japan, and many, many more.
